Named in honor of the Revolutionary War hero Nathanael Greene, Greeneville is rooted in a rich history. Greeneville was also home to the 17th President of the United States, featuring the Andrew Johnson National Historic Site and National Cemetery. A number of specialty museums display more of Greeneville’s past, including the City Garage Car Museum, Dickson Williams Mansion, and the Greeneville-Greene County History Museum.
Nestled in the foothills of the Appalachian Mountains, Greeneville is surrounded by natural beauty and abundant recreational opportunities at numerous public parks, golf courses, and on the Appalachian Trail. The Nolichucky River is nearby Greeneville as well.
Greenville touts a small-town atmosphere within close proximity to big-city amenities in Johnson City and Knoxville as well as Asheville, North Carolina. Quick highway access makes getting around from Greeneville easy.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
